GREY LINE SERVICE Goes 2-A-Day

Morgantown, WV- Mountain Line is pleased to announce an increase in our Grey Line service.  Beginning Thursday, April 1, the Grey Line will offer service to the Pittsburgh Airport twice daily, with departures from Morgantown at 9:30 AM and 3:30 PM with arrivals at Pittsburgh Airport at 11:30 AM and 6:15 PM, respectively.  Two-a-Day trips will also be available to Pittsburgh Greyhound with arrivals at 12:15 PM and 5:30 PM.  In addition the Grey Line will be running southbound trips to accommodate Mylan workers and other commuters traveling from Harrison or Marion Counties.

 
As a part of this service increase, Mountain Line will be offering a new, “Monthly Monster Pass” with unlimited rides on all local routes and all Grey Line runs.  This non-transferable pass is available for purchase online at shop.mountainline.org.   Complete schedules and additional details for these new services can be found at www.busride.org or by calling 304-296-3869.
